well since the fencer focuses on the health pool mainly, you may want to consider picking up a pistol to go with it


i am very pleased with my character's build so far


i have just enough ch skills to call a sludge panther, novice medic to use a stim B and had enough left over to train pistol whip and stopping shot in the pistoleer tree


yes this build is patheticlly combat oriented, but at least i am pretty **edit** hard to take down in pvp


i love charging in with a pistol only to switch to my vibro when the person least expects it


lunge/dizzy is your friend and if used correctly it should be the start of a lethal combo of attacks that will leave your opponent down and out with no chance of getting back up



on a side note, despite what others have said about not being able to attack while running after a ranged player, i have had good success with it so far


when the player realizes that a "Blademaster" is not someone who makes blades, they tend to get scared and run off with good reason


i enjoy using the burst run after these kiters, and when i get close enough the lunge attack still seems to work for me


at this point the opponent is toast, and i wack him back to the clone center
